Despite the Disappearance of OpenAI and Jony Ive’s ‘IO’ Brand, Their AI Hardware Partnership Endures

admin

OpenAI has removed references to io, a hardware startup co-founded by Apple designer Jony Ive, from its website and social media. This follows OpenAI’s announcement of a nearly $6.5 billion acquisition aimed at creating dedicated AI hardware. Although OpenAI confirmed that the acquisition deal is still progressing, they have taken down related content due to a trademark lawsuit from Iyo, a hearing device startup developed from Google’s moonshot factory. The original announcement blog post and a video featuring Ive and OpenAI CEO Sam Altman have been made unavailable. OpenAI spokesperson Kayla Wood stated that the content removal was due to a court order linked to the trademark complaint regarding the name “io,” which OpenAI disputes and is currently reviewing.
